Statuettes serve as a way to shift the narrative. Every complaint about the random nature of BLC's and the Keys needed to open them is short-circuited by the existence of Statuettes. Their very existence would allow ANet -- if challenged over gambling -- to point at Statuettes and say, "See. There is a way to get items that players want without depending solely on random number generation." Consideration of gambling evaporates at that point because the random nature of chest drops only does two things: gives random pixel stuff that may or may not be desirable; or gives a player the desired item sooner than they would get it via the "sure" way of collecting the Statuettes. The narrative shifts at that point to be about the cost of attaining the item. Aversion to cost is fine, but no lawmaking body in the free world is going to tell a company it cannot price its products at too high a price for some consumers' tastes.

 

You are suggesting that ANet put certain items currently gotten via chests as standalone purchases. That is your right as a consumer. However, be careful what you ask for. The only way accepting your suggestion works from a business perspective would be if ANet were to price the standalone item at more than it would cost to get it via Statuette. ANet is not going to be motivated to take less money than the market will bear so some consumers can get what they want, and taking the same amount of money would be a waste of code and space in the TP.

I won't complain too much about the BLC's being random - that is there point after all. If I use one, I understand that I might not get a great drop. However, what is somewhat annoying is that most of the stuff is account bound. So I may get a drop that too me is worthless, but other people would value it highly. And likewise, they may get a drop that they consider worthless but I would consider valuable. But we can not in any way trade these items, so we are both stuck with crap we don't really want. So if they could remove account bound, or have some trade in program, I might be a more inclined to use chests - if I get something I can not use, at least I could get some value from it.

However, this would probably reduce their sales in some ways also, which is why Anet has everything account bound. But it does mean that the chance of me getting a random drop from a BLTC of anything remotely valuable to me is really low, so I'm just not inclined to spend anymore on keys.
